John Arthur Ruskin Munro (1864-1944) was Rector of Lincoln College, Oxford, and an archaelogist and historian.
Two volumes of lectures by J.A.R. Munro, consisting of:
- Lectures on aspects of Greece in the sixth century BC
- Lectures on the history of Athens, in the form of biographies of nine Athenian statesmen
The volumes were given to the Library by Mrs M.C.N. Munro in 1967.
